Subject: Cold storage archival — action for new folks

Team,

We're archiving the Brindlevault cold storage buckets this Friday. If you joined in the last quarter: anything you need from buckets tagged `frost-*`, pull it before Thursday noon. After archival, restores take 48 hours minimum and need a ticket. No exceptions, no reminders. The archival job runs under the Mossgate pipeline, same as last cycle. Questions go to the release channel, not DMs. Reference build for the archival run is below.

build token for yajof-bajof: htk31_506ff1188f74596b5bb2eec94edc43c

## Tilecache Prefetcher: Stalled Queue Recovery

When the Marbleview prefetcher reports a stalled queue, first confirm that the tile source (Cartwheel renderer) is responding before restarting anything. A restart while Cartwheel is down will flood the retry queue and delay recovery by hours. Check the prefetcher's depth gauge; if it exceeds 50k tiles, drain in batches of 5k using the throttle toggle. Full drain procedures, gauge thresholds, and rollback steps are documented on the internal page below.

wiki page, tahaf-tajog: https://jira.ordindyn.corp/pipeline

This page covers the service account used by Quellhorn, our on-call alert deduplicator. Quick context for review: the dedupe worker reads from the alert firehose and writes suppression records back, so its account needs both subscribe and write scopes — don't trim either in your review or the suppression table silently stops updating (ask Priya how we learned that). The account rotates monthly via the credstore job. If you need to run the integration tests locally, use the key below.

gateway credential: kto23_LX9A4ys6i4nzHtpOLNLodKK

Subject: Cut-over complete — currency rounding fix

Team, the cut-over to the new Marrowpoint conversion service finished last night. Rounding now happens once, at final settlement, using banker's rounding, which eliminates the per-line-item drift that caused penny discrepancies in multi-currency invoices. Reconciliation against last quarter showed zero variance. For future reference, the service went live with the following configuration.

config for kafof-bawef:
holath:
  log_level: debug
  metrics_host: metrics.holath.qorvelsys.internal
  pin: 2191
  pool_size: 32